WebStorm è un ambiente di sviluppo integrato (IDE), il quale fornisce un ampio set di strumenti rivolti alla programmazione ed al supporto di diverse tecnologie web. È utilizzabile in ambiti di sviluppo di applicazioni basate su linguaggi quali XML, CSS, HMTL e JavaScript, rivelando una buona versatilità d'uso. Il tool è disponibile per i sistemi operativi Mac e Windows e prevede le opzioni tipicamente richieste nella stesura di codice. Il correttore ortografico integrato si adatta al contesto ed in modo automatico controlla commenti, stringhe e tags, al fine di ridurre possibili errori.
WebStorm offre un'interfaccia la quale risulta familiare sin dal primo avvio, specialmente per i professionisti e gli utenti più esperti. Nella finestra principale, in pochi e semplici passaggi, si riescono ad aprire o creare i progetti d'interesse. Il menu contestuale relativo al progetto in corso include un insieme di voci con le quali eseguire ad esempio il debug o la compilazione dei file. Combinazioni personalizzabili di tasti rapidi consentono poi di eseguire più velocemente i comandi di uso comune. Ulteriori funzioni di editing sono l'evidenziazione della sintassi, il completamento automatico delle istruzioni e la ricerca avanzata di stringhe.